The Phantom Model: How a Dubious AI Article Exposes Crypto Media’s Verification Crisis

LeoFox Web3

Last week, a blockchain-focused news outlet published a breathless piece about a new open-source AI model called “Qwen 3.8-27B.” It claimed the model—a 27-billion-parameter dense multimodal beast—could run on a single 17GB GPU after quantization, handle 262,144 tokens of context, and understand images and video. The article was shared widely in crypto Telegram groups, hailed as a breakthrough for decentralized AI. But there was one problem: the model doesn’t exist. At least, not under that name. And the data points presented were a Frankenstein’s monster of real specifications from different versions of Qwen, stitched together with enough technical plausibility to fool even seasoned developers.

But here’s where the cracks appear. The article’s technical details, while individually plausible, don’t add up to a coherent whole. A 27B dense model in FP16 requires about 54GB of memory. After 4-bit quantization, that drops to roughly 14GB for the weights alone. Add overhead for KV cache and inference runtime, and 17GB is feasible for short contexts. But the article also claimed support for 262K tokens of context—and that’s where the math breaks. The KV cache alone for a 27B model at 262K tokens can eat up 10–20GB, pushing total memory well beyond 17GB. The 17GB figure is a “best case” that ignores the very features the article hyped.

More damning is the model name. “Qwen 3.8-27B” doesn’t appear on HuggingFace, GitHub, or any official Alibaba channel. The closest real models are Qwen2.5-VL-27B and the Qwen3-VL series (which uses MoE architectures, not dense). The article’s reference to a “2.4T parameter predecessor” is nonsensical—no such model exists in the Qwen lineup. The most charitable explanation is that the author confused multiple versions; the less charitable one is that the article was AI-generated, stitching together plausible-sounding facts from different sources to produce SEO bait.

First, I look for missing benchmarks. The article spent paragraphs on hardware requirements but zero on performance. How does this model score on MMMU, Video-MME, or OCRBench? Without benchmarks, the “17GB” claim is just a number—it says nothing about whether the model is useful. In my experience, when a technical article omits performance metrics, it’s either because the numbers are bad or because the author doesn’t have them. Both are red flags.

Second, I examine the quantization story. 4-bit quantization is standard, but it degrades quality, especially for multimodal tasks. The article didn’t mention any loss metrics. Based on my analysis of similar models, a 27B dense model at 4-bit can lose 5–15% accuracy on vision tasks. The article’s silence on this is a form of information selectivity—it tells you what you want to hear, not what you need to know.
